Applicants must hold a recognized bachelor's degree in medicine, neuroscience, nursing, or a related health science field with a minimum second-class honours or equivalent. Relevant professional experience is preferred but not mandatory. Candidates should demonstrate proficiency in English and submit two academic references. A personal statement outlining motivation and career goals related to neurology and gerontology is required. Some programmes may require an interview or additional assessments. International students must meet visa and health insurance requirements. Official transcripts and degree certificates must be provided. Prior exposure to clinical or research environments in neurology or geriatrics will strengthen the application. All documents must be submitted in English or accompanied by certified translations. Applicants whose first language is not English must provide evidence of proficiency through recognized tests such as IELTS (minimum overall score of 6.5 with no band below 6.0), TOEFL (minimum 90 overall), or equivalent. Some programmes may accept alternative qualifications or exemptions based on prior education in English. Proof of language ability ensures candidates can successfully engage with academic content and clinical communication. English language test results must be recent, typically within two years of application. The college may offer additional language support services if needed.

Graduates from the Royal College of Surgeons in Ireland may be eligible for post-study work permits allowing them to gain professional experience in Ireland. The Third Level Graduate Scheme permits non-EEA students to remain in Ireland for up to 24 months after completing their studies to seek employment. This opportunity enables graduates to apply their specialized knowledge in neurology and gerontology within clinical settings, research institutions, or healthcare organizations. Work experience gained can enhance career prospects globally. The college offers career guidance and job placement support to facilitate transition into the workforce. Graduates should ensure compliance with visa conditions during post-study employment.
